## Cron Migration to Flowline

All remaining cron jobs on the legacy boxes move to Flowline by end of quarter. Priority order: billing exports, then report digests, then cleanup tasks. Each migrated job needs a workflow definition, a retry policy, and an owner tag. Test in the staging namespace first; production deploys go through the normal pipeline. Don't copy old crontab timings blindly — several overlap and should be staggered. Staging auth uses the internal key below.

gateway credential: kto3_qfe

# DeployBot ("Quillhorn") posts deploy status to the #releases room.
# It polls the Lattermill pipeline API, diffs against last known state,
# and only announces transitions. Don't add chatter: every extra message
# trains people to mute the bot. Rate limits below were picked after the
# 2023 incident where retries flooded the room during a pipeline outage.
# If you change the poll interval, change the backoff cap to match, or
# stale states will linger. The tuning constants are as follows.

tuning constants:
RATE_LIMITS = {
    "wenwyn": 1,
    "zorix": 10,
    "oliix": 2,
    "holael": 10,
}

Onboarding: Date Localization — GlintRelease Pipeline

All user-facing dates go through the LocaleForge formatter; never hand-roll patterns. Release builds must pass the locale matrix (14 locales) before tagging. Pseudo-locale runs nightly; failures block the train. Translation bundles are signed at build time. To re-sign bundles after a key rotation, unlock the signing store with the passphrase below.

vault phrase of tajef-tafog = istox-sorax-zorox-casok-holox-kelix-weneth-drueth-casion

**Q: How do I unlock the archive for the Crashgale pipeline if the ingest node is rebuilt?**

A: Crashgale collects crash reports from the Lumabird mobile apps, symbolicates them, and writes archives to encrypted storage in the Westpool cluster. After a node rebuild, the ingest daemon cannot decrypt historical archives until the vault is re-opened. Run `crashgale vault unlock` from the rebuilt node, confirm the fingerprint matches the one in the ops wiki, and wait for the prompt. When prompted, enter the recovery passphrase below.

unlock words, hahip-baduf: holwyn-istath-julvan